Output d3c613dc252d044ab9a7526eb1bab32d4088c703982de407b9e7d626e10ea74e:0

value
33807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57bc5831d5185c151b6f41c5ec2699ae13087795 OP_EQUAL
address
MFu4eXRpXFgZ6Y7Rr7ECAu3GNH1KkdXPge
transaction
d3c613dc252d044ab9a7526eb1bab32d4088c703982de407b9e7d626e10ea74e
spent
true